Canada Canola Processing Fell 14% in Week; Soy Crush Rose 5.4%

Canadian mills processed 14 percent less canola and soybean crushing rose 5.4 percent in the week ended July 18, compared with a week earlier, an industry group said.
Mills crushed 123,136 metric tons of canola, also known as rapeseed, and 30,533 tons of soybeans, the Winnipeg, Manitoba- based Canadian Oilseed Processors Association said today in an e-mail.
